Everyone
在 Windows 中,什么是适合从磁盘权限中删除用户的命令?
答案1
您需要安装这个:-Sysinterals 套件 在 Powershell 中:
[C:\]psgetsid Everyone
PsGetSid v1.44 - Translates SIDs to names and vice versa
Copyright (C) 1999-2008 Mark Russinovich
Sysinternals - www.sysinternals.com
SID for BUILTIN\Everyone:
<SID>
icacls <drive>\*.* /remove:g *<SID> /T
再次,首先在较小的文件夹子集上进行测试。
这是可行的,但已被 icacls 取代,详情如上所述。
实际上不是 powershell,但你可以运行
cacls.exe *.* /e /g Everyone:n
这应该将整个磁盘上的每个人都设置为无权限。
请务必先在单个文件/文件夹上进行测试,以确保它不会破坏其他用户的访问。
我使用以下链接作为参考。
Microsoft TechNet 库 Cacls